    Análise diacrônica dos verbos "ser" e "estar" com sentido existencial no português em cartas de leitor do século XIX da cidade do Recife
    (2018-08-27) Vasconcelos Neto, Marcionilo José de; Lima, Emanuelle Camila Moraes de Melo Albuquerque; http://lattes.cnpq.br/0470905904340465; http://lattes.cnpq.br/3002130100167194
    The present work seeks to undertake a diachronic analysis regarding the use of copular verbs with existential meaning, since they represent one of the greatest challenges for researchers who are interested in the subject. In order to carry out this research, we used historical data from nineteenth century reader's letters to newspapers in the city of Recife, as well as data from a survey with contemporary Portuguese speakers about this phenomenon. This research is based on the assumptions of the generative theory, and as main references, we have the studies of Chomsky (1981, 1986), Avellar (2004, 2007), Sibaldo (2009, 2016) and Tarallo (2009). This work endeavors to contribute to the growth of the literature on copulatives with an existential meaning, and also offers some analysis from the findings in the corpus, bringing some syntactic-semantic analysis about the diachronic variation that can be found in the use of the Brazilian Portuguese verb "to be" with an existential sense.
